Output 032430ec98d8027d40ededd6f6bff1bf2d4397aaf69b8b9606a2a578149b88eb:0

value
99270319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2700907b8275d1cf9599c3a13ad73779ab8e792 OP_EQUAL
address
MRdFXzXMWPvtLqLYzLBQoVhDD5ucYYbZZs
transaction
032430ec98d8027d40ededd6f6bff1bf2d4397aaf69b8b9606a2a578149b88eb
spent
true